36 [CHORUS]
Buttons for enabling / disabling the chorus eect and to select the chorus type.
37 [EQ]
Buttons for selecting a preprogrammed tone colour (EQ type).
38 [DUET]
Button for selecting a preprogrammed duet accompaniment (duet type).
39 [HARMONY]
Buttons for selecting a preset in harmony mode.
40 [MELODY OFF]
Buttons for enabling / disabling the practice mode and to mute the right or left hand voice.
41 [METRONOME]
Buttons for selecting the metronome sound.
42 [ACCOMP]
Buttons for increasing / decreasing the accompaniment track volume.

43 [TEMPO]
Buttons for increasing / decreasing the playback speed.
44 [STYLE]
Buttons for selecting a style.
45 [SONG]
Buttons for selecting a song.
46 [MIDI]
Buttons for setting values in MIDI mode.
